LOGISTICS POINTE/GARLAND ANNOUNCES

NEW 146,000 SQUARE-FOOT TENANT

 

DALLAS – June 10, 2014 – Westmount Realty Capital, LLC, a Dallas-based real estate investment company, is pleased to announce a new lease for Logistics Pointe/Garland with Garden Ridge, LP.  The 146,600 square-foot lease is for warehouse space and associated truck trailer parking.  

 

Garden Ridge was founded in 1979 and began as Garden Ridge Pottery. The chain has grown to over 65 stores in over 21 states and is the home décor superstore that offers a vast assortment of products at affordable prices, including home accent items, rugs, furniture, wall art and more.

 

Logistics Pointe/Garland located at 2600 McCree Road in Garland, Texas, was acquired by a Westmount affiliate in June 2012.  The property, located immediately adjacent to Interstate 635 at McCree Road, has a prime location in the northeast Dallas industrial submarket, the second largest and among the most active in DFW.  Originally built in several phases as a single-tenant, owner occupied Safeway (Tom Thumb) regional distribution center, the property currently is a 1.13 million square-foot dry storage and warehouse center plus 40 percent freezer/cooler space situated on a 66-acre rail-served site.  Westmount has completed major improvements on the interior and exterior including painting, signage, lighting, parking lot improvements, compliance and utility upgrades, refrigeration equipment and upgrades, along with a new, attractive guard station at the entrance. 

 

When acquired, the property was 70 percent leased to several strong national and regional tenants.  Current leasing and the addition of Garden Ridge brings occupancy to approximately 85.5 percent.  Many of the current tenants are in the food distribution industry such as Provide Commerce (Pro Flowers and Shari’s Berries), Brothers Produce, LaBodega Meat and Calavo Growers.  The property also serves tenants in the supply chain management and recycling transportation such as National Distribution Centers and Greenstar Mid-America. 

 

Nathan Lawrence of CBRE was the tenant broker in the transaction, and David Sours and Kevin Kelley of CBRE represented the Landlord.
